Output 2476195d625423e4d0b6f92f8b5e9313de08c697650d3b52c9791976002a804d:26

value
30178469
script pubkey
OP_0 OP_PUSHBYTES_20 16ea34fc47b170d481d850addd747e73dabb0af6
address
ltc1qzm4rflz8k9cdfqwc2zka6ar7w0dtkzhknlper9
transaction
2476195d625423e4d0b6f92f8b5e9313de08c697650d3b52c9791976002a804d
spent
true